# Conclusion

Three required target columns need acquisition or sourcing. The consultant confirmed each gap and accepted it for phase-two scope. In this wiki, **gap** means no current candidate was identified inside the audited Desktop model; it does not mean the information is absent from all upstream systems.

## `Account.AccountGroup`

- **Target definition:** management reporting group above account type.
- **Type:** String.
- **Declared source:** account master / embedded mapping.
- **Current comparison:** no selected current candidate.
- **Decision:** confirm gap; `acquire_or_source`; accepted for phase-two scope.

An implementation design needs an authoritative account-level join key, effective-dating rules if classifications change, ownership and handling for unmapped accounts.

## `Ledger.CostCentre`

- **Target definition:** management cost-centre code.
- **Type:** String.
- **Declared source:** finance posting source / embedded reference data.
- **Current comparison:** no selected current candidate.
- **Decision:** confirm gap; `acquire_or_source`; accepted for phase-two scope.

The source grain must be resolved. A cost centre could be sourced directly per ledger posting or derived through governed reference data; the evidence does not decide between these options.

## `Ledger.CurrencyCode`

- **Target definition:** ISO reporting currency code.
- **Type:** String.
- **Declared source:** finance posting source.
- **Current comparison:** no selected current candidate.
- **Decision:** confirm gap; `acquire_or_source`; accepted for phase-two scope.

The currency design must be reconciled with `Ledger.SignedAmount`, which the target describes as an amount in reporting currency. It is unknown whether the current ledger is single-currency, already converted, or requires transaction/reporting currency separation.

## Reference-data caution

The workbook's hidden `Reference Data` sheet includes illustrative values for all three concepts. The workbook instructions prevent treating that sheet automatically as the target declaration. It must not be promoted to a production source without confirmation of completeness, keys, governance and ownership.
